Red Sox Prospect Gives Epic Response to 'Overrated' Chants
Kim Klement Neitzel-Imagn Images

The Boston Red Sox have a trio of star prospects that have been making noise in their path to MLB.

Outfielder Roman Anthony is among the group, ranking as baseball's No. 2 overall prospect and No. 1 overall positional prospect according to MLB.com. 

The 20-year-old posted a .272/.403/.466 slash line in AAA last season. His MLB.com scouting report describes his plate presence with "advanced swing decisions, quick stroke and growing strength [that] allow him to make more consistent contact and generate higher exit velocities than most players his age."

The Red Sox lost Thursday's MLB Spring Breakout Game in Port Charlotte, Fla. 7-5 to the Tampa Bay Rays' prospects, but Anthony still delivered the moment of the night.

Anthony was met with "overrated!" chants from the crowd and seamlessly responded by blasting a home run into right field. 

Outfielder Kristian Campbell (No. 7 overall) and shortstop Marcelo Mayer (No. 12 overall), who round out the touted threesome, also launched their own long balls in the game. 

“I think any time we get to play together, it's enjoyable,” said Anthony. “So it’s fun. It was good. Honestly, more than just the three of us, playing with these guys we don't get to play with every day, and seeing some of these guys, seeing some of the young talent we have, the guys at the lower levels, it's exciting.”

Campbell's home run was also in a critical moment. With two outs in the top of the third inning, the right-handed hitter smacked an opposite-field, two-run homer off Rays No. 11 prospect Trevor Harrison.

“Gap to gap,” said Campell. “That’s my power, is going gap to gap, to the big part of the field. Just try to hit the ball hard and in the air and good things happen.”
